21xrx.com
2024-11-08 23:30:54 Friday
登录
文章检索 我的文章 写文章
Java与C语言的区别和应用场景比较
2023-06-13 12:44:13 深夜i     --     --

Java和C语言都是常见的编程语言,具有不同的特点和应用场景。C语言是一种高效的编程语言,广泛应用于系统开发和嵌入式设备,而Java则更加适用于网络应用和移动端开发。在本文中,我们将对Java和C语言进行详细比较,并探讨它们的优缺点以及适用场景。

Java与C语言比较

Java是面向对象的编程语言,具有可移植性、安全性和可靠性等优点。Java程序运行在虚拟机上,并具有跨平台性,可以在不同的计算机系统上运行。Java还具有许多强大的库函数和API,可以方便地进行网络编程和应用开发。

C语言则是一种基础的编程语言,具有高效的性能和底层的系统编程能力。C语言可以直接访问硬件设备,比如控制IO设备的输入输出,以及内存分配和管理等。C语言广泛应用于系统软件和嵌入式开发等方面。

Java与C语言适用场景比较

Java适用于网络应用开发、大型企业级应用开发、Web开发、移动应用开发等方面。Java具有自动内存管理和异常处理机制,能够提高程序的安全性和稳定性。Java还与众多的框架和库相兼容,可以方便地进行开发和维护。

C语言则适用于系统软件、操作系统、驱动程序、嵌入式开发等方面。C语言具有直接访问硬件功能和高效性能的优点,适合于对性能要求高的软件开发。

Java跟C语言的关键词

1. Java

2. C语言

3. 应用场景

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复